Purpose

This tool parses a command-line application's `--help` output and generates a markdown file. This markdown file acts as an "Agent Skill" that instructs AI models on how to use the CLI tool, allowing developers to replace persistent MCP servers with on-demand bash commands to save memory.

Security Assessment

Overall Risk: Low. The codebase was scanned and contains no dangerous patterns, hardcoded secrets, or requests for excessive permissions. The primary function is parsing help text and creating markdown files locally. However, by design, it creates instructions for AI agents to execute shell commands. The security risk depends entirely on the external CLI tools you convert into skills and whether those tools handle sensitive data or perform harmful network requests.

Quality Assessment

The project is very new and has low community visibility with only 6 GitHub stars. Despite this, it is actively maintained, with the most recent push occurring today. It is a lightweight utility that boasts zero external dependencies, which is a significant positive factor for security and reliability. The repository is properly licensed under the MIT license, making it safe for personal and commercial use.

Verdict

Safe to use, though you should expect early-stage software quirks and personally verify the safety of any CLI tools you convert into agent skills.

The Problem · 问题

EN: 15 MCP servers accumulated 400+ zombie processes on a 32GB Windows machine, exhausting virtual memory commit charge (0xC000012D). Every fork() failed. The system was completely dead.

CN: 15 个 MCP server 在 32GB Windows 机器上积累了 400+ 僵尸进程,耗尽虚拟内存 commit charge(0xC000012D),所有 fork() 失败,系统彻底死机。

Each MCP server spawns a 3-layer process tree that never exits:

每个 MCP server 产生一个三层进程树,session 结束后不回收:

cmd.exe          ← shell wrapper / 壳
  └── uv.exe       ← Python launcher / 启动器
       └── python.exe  ← MCP server / 服务进程

× 15 servers = 45+ persistent processes → system dead in 5-10 sessions

The Solution · 解决方案

Don't run a server. Just run a command.

别跑服务器,跑命令就行。

# Before (MCP): persistent process, leaks memory, hard to debug
# 之前 (MCP): 常驻进程,泄漏内存,难调试
Agent --JSON-RPC--> MCP Server (persistent) --API--> Backend

# After (CLI + Skill): runs, returns, exits
# 之后 (CLI + Skill): 跑完退出,零开销
Agent --Bash tool--> CLI (on-demand) --API--> Backend

cli2skill parses any CLI's --help and generates an Agent Skill — a markdown file that teaches your AI agent when and how to call your tool.

Why Not MCP · 为什么不用 MCP

MCP Server CLI + Skill
🔴 Processes / 进程 3 per server, persistent 1 per call, exits immediately
🔴 Memory / 内存 Accumulates across sessions Zero when idle
🔴 Debugging / 调试 JSON-RPC over stdio pipes Plain stderr
🔴 Token cost / Token 开销 150k per workflow 2k per workflow*
🟢 Platforms / 平台 Claude Code only 26+ via Agent Skills spec

* Anthropic's own benchmark: code execution vs direct MCP tool calls = 98.7% token savings.

When MCP IS right · MCP 仍然适用的场景

  • 🟢 Persistent browser sessions / 持久化浏览器会话
  • 🟢 Multi-client shared servers / 多客户端共享服务
  • 🟢 Streaming notifications / 流式通知推送
  • 🟢 Remote HTTP endpoints (Slack, GitHub, Notion) / 远程 HTTP 端点

Rule of thumb / 经验法则: If your tool is "call → return result", use CLI + Skill. If it needs persistent state or push notifications, MCP is fine.

Supported Formats · 支持的格式

Framework / 框架 Language / 语言 Detection / 检测方式
argparse / Click / Typer Python command description
Cobra Go command: description
Commander.js TypeScript command description
clap Rust command description
Any CLI / 任意 Any / 任意 Generic --help parsing
